Dolan Media Company to Report Fourth Quarter and Year-End 2007 Financial Results on March 27, 2008
Business Wire, Feb 26, 2008
MINNEAPOLIS -- Dolan Media Company (NYSE: DM), a leading provider of business information and professional services to the legal, financial and real estate sectors in the United States, today announced that it will report its financial results for the fourth quarter and year-end 2007, on Thursday, March 27, 2008, after the market close.
In conjunction with an earnings press release, the company will host a conference call to discuss the results on Thursday, March 27, 2008, beginning at 3:30 p.m. Central Standard Time (4:30 p.m. Eastern Standard Time). Participating in the call will be James P. Dolan, chairman, chief executive officer and president, and Scott Pollei, executive vice president and chief financial officer.
The conference call will be webcast live over the Internet and can be accessed at the investor relations section of the company's web site at www.dolanmedia.com. Interested parties should access the webcast approximately 10-15 minutes before the scheduled start time. A replay will be available approximately one hour after completion of the conference call and will remain available for 21 days on the company's website.
Dolan Media Company's Business Information Division produces business journals, court and commercial media and other publications, operates web sites and conducts a broad range of events for targeted professional audiences in each of the 21 geographic markets that it serves across the United States. The Company's Professional Services Division provides specialized services to the legal profession through its American Processing Company, LLC (APC) and Counsel Press, LLC (Counsel Press) units. APC is a leading provider of mortgage default processing services to law firms in the United States and Counsel Press is the nation's largest provider of appellate services to the legal community.
